The HC may consider the plea on Wednesday, in which she said she was invited in her official capacity by Cambridge University to speak at a conference to be held on June 15.
In her plea, Atishi, said that requiring constitutional functionaries and ministers in the state government to seek the Centre's 'political clearance' for travelling abroad violates the dignity and independence of a constitutional office.
